acl: add NEON optimization for ARMv8
authorJerin Jacob <jerin.jacob@caviumnetworks.com>
Fri, 6 Nov 2015 09:40:27 +0000 (15:10 +0530)
committerThomas Monjalon <thomas.monjalon@6wind.com>
Wed, 18 Nov 2015 21:44:01 +0000 (22:44 +0100)
commit34fa6c27c15612ba2c7b9d18828512f95443e400
tree8bbc40c00cb91e6d18b3b79d64a99d068d315cab
parent97523f822ba93236e6550cffcda3b11a85777735
acl: add NEON optimization for ARMv8

The implementation uses NEON gcc intrinsic.
Verified with testacl and acl_autotest applications on arm64 architecture.

Signed-off-by: Jerin Jacob <jerin.jacob@caviumnetworks.com>
Acked-by: Konstantin Ananyev <konstantin.ananyev@intel.com>
app/test-acl/main.c
lib/librte_acl/Makefile
lib/librte_acl/acl.h
lib/librte_acl/acl_run_neon.c [new file with mode: 0644]
lib/librte_acl/acl_run_neon.h [new file with mode: 0644]
lib/librte_acl/rte_acl.c
lib/librte_acl/rte_acl.h